5 stars This album just kicks right from the start and doesn't let up until the end of the album. There are a ton of good musical ideas flowing. Todd is flexing his prog muscles for the first time here and he seems to be a master of his craft.

The "Utopia Theme" kicks it off with a fusion flavor and rocks you out the door. It is relentless and wild.

"Freak Parade" doesn't let up either. Man, there is some cool fusion, with a Jeff Beck vibe to it.

"Freedom Fighters" is the made for radio rocker. It is the shortest of the bunch and it is pretty cool also.

The best is last in the 30 minute epic "The Ikon." I first heard Todd Rungren from AM radio when he released "We Gotta Get You a Woman." With this album, I found out just how well he does play the guitar. Man, this guy knows his stuff!

This is a must have recording and I give it 5 stars.
